NPCC Rewards Excellence in Style and Professionalism
Today, September 4, 2025, the Nigerian Ports Consultative Council (NPCC) once again demonstrated its commitment to motivating and celebrating its workforce by recognizing excellence in an inspiring way.
In a brief yet memorable ceremony at the NPCC Secretariat, the Council’s leadership—Chairman Mr. Bolaji Sunmola and Vice Chairperson Chief Mrs. Jean Chiazor Anishere, SAN—presented a special award to a staff member, Mr. Akinsola Ayodeji Peter, who emerged as the best-dressed staff member for the (June-August) quarter. The award, a cheque of ₦25,000, was personally handed over by the Vice Chairperson, who commended the recipient for not only projecting elegance but also reflecting the council’s values of discipline, dignity, and professionalism.

Chairman Sunmola, in his remarks, emphasized that appearance in the workplace is more than fashion—it is an expression of self-respect and the corporate image of the Council. He went further to challenge all staff to embrace excellence as a lifestyle, promising an additional reward for any staff who consistently win the award for three consecutive quarters.
This initiative, now becoming a cherished tradition within NPCC, does more than recognize neatness and style. It reinforces the Council’s belief that motivation can be found in both big and small acts of recognition and that every effort—from intellectual contributions to personal presentation—matters in building a workplace of excellence.

The award has sparked renewed excitement among staff, many of whom see it as a reminder that professionalism begins with how one presents oneself daily. Beyond the financial incentive, the recognition sends a strong message that NPCC is intentional about nurturing a positive, vibrant, and value-driven work culture.
